In Neishaboor Abu Saโeed Muhammad ibn Al-Fadhl ibn Muhammad ibn Ishaq al-Mothakkir al-Neishaboori narrated that Abu Ali Al-Hassan ibn Ali al-Khazraji Al-Ansari al-Saโdi quoted on the authority of Abdul Salam ibn Salih Abu Salt al-Harawi, โI was with Ali ibn Musa Ar-Ridhaโ (a.s.) when he was leaving Neishaboor. He was riding in a carriage pulled by a grayish mule. Then Muhammad ibn Rafeโa, Ahmad ibn al-Harith, Yahya ibn Yahya, Ishaq ibn Rahovayeh and some of the scholars grabbed the muleโs harness at Marbaโat and said, โBy your forefathers, the Pure! Please narrate a tradition for us from your father.โ Then he brought his head out of the carriage. He was wearing a double-sided fur cloak. He (a.s.) said, โMy father Musa ibn Jaโfar (a.s.) - the good-doing servant -narrated that his father Jaโfar ibn Muhammad As-Sadiq (a.s.) quoted on the authority of his father Abu Jaโfar Muhammad ibn Ali (a.s.) - the analyzer of the Knowledge of the Prophets - on the authority of his father Ali ibn Al-Husayn (a.s.) - the Master of the Worshippers - on the authority of his father Al-Husayn (a.s.) - the Master of Youth in Paradise - on the authority of his father Ali ibn Abi Talib (a.s.), on the authority of Godโs Prophet (S) that he had heard Gabriel say that God - the Exalted the Magnificent - say, โI am God. There is no god but Me. Worship Me then. Whoever of you sincerely witnesses to โthere is no god but Godโ can enter My Stronghold. And whoever enters My Stronghold is secure from My punishment.โ
